How gas prices have changed in Mississippi in the last week
SUMMARY: Gasoline prices are on the rise, with drivers in states like Texas, Alaska, Oregon, and Washington D.C. seeing the largest weekly increases. Factors such as trade disruptions, refinery troubles, low supply, and increasing demand are contributing to the price hike. Analysts warn that this trend may continue as Houthi attacks on ships passing through the Suez Canal add costs, and the U.S. faces a dwindling oil supply. Mississippi currently has gas prices at $3.01, with the Biloxi-Gulfport-Pascagoula metro area having the highest prices in the state. California, Hawaii, and Washington have the most expensive gas, while Mississippi, Colorado, and Texas have the least expensive.

Ole Miss women get pair of double-doubles and roll to 83-65 March Madness win over Ball State
SUMMARY: Mississippi coach Yolett McPhee-McCuin found solace in returning to a different arena in Waco, Texas, following a disappointing previous tournament experience. The No. 5 seed Ole Miss Rebels redeemed themselves with an 83-65 victory over 12th-seeded Ball State in the NCAA Tournament’s first round. Starr Jacobs led the Rebels with 18 points and 11 rebounds, while Kennedy Todd-Williams and Madison Scott each scored 15 points. Ole Miss dominated rebounding, leading 52-32, and will face fourth-seeded Baylor next. Coach McPhee-McCuin noted the team’s evolution since their last visit and the significance of playing in Texas, where Jacobs feels at home.
